About 85 Keir Hardie Avenue

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

85 Keir Hardie Avenue is a semi-detached house in Bootle (L20 0DN). It has a recorded floor area of 80 m² (around 861 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(March 2013) shows a D (score 55),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from March 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Across 2002–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£168,000 is 35.5% above the 2019 sale price. Most recent transfer: March 2019 at £124,000.
